description | In the evolving landscape of health information management, the application of blockchain and edge computing technologies to chronic disease management remains underexplored, despite the urgent need for scalable, secure, and real-time solutions. This systematic review examines the integration of these technologies in healthcare, with a specific focus on diabetes management. We analyzed 52 studies, categorizing findings into three key areas: enhanced data security and privacy through decentralized frameworks and tamper-proof storage; real-time data processing, enabled by edge computing for immediate analytics and alerts; and scalability, achieved via hybrid architectures that optimize data handling. Our review identifies critical gaps in the existing literature, particularly the lack of tailored approaches for chronic disease contexts like diabetes, and outlines future directions for developing robust, secure, scalable, and real-time data solutions. This study provides a foundation for innovation in healthcare technology that can significantly impact diabetes care and chronic disease management. |
